Unpacking the Content: Key Themes and Moments
Okay, let's get into the nitty-gritty. What are the key themes and moments that make the Harry & Meghan docuseries so compelling? First and foremost, the series is a love story. It chronicles the development of their relationship, from the early days of dating to the challenges of building a family under intense public scrutiny. It's a genuine portrayal of two people who clearly care deeply for each other. They talk about their early courtship, the initial excitement, and the challenges they faced as their relationship became public. The series then moves on to explore their decision to step back from their roles as senior royals. They explain their reasons, including the desire for more privacy and the need to protect their family. The couple discusses the various factors that contributed to their decision, providing context to a story that has been widely debated and scrutinized. Then, the docuseries explores the role of the British media in their lives. They share their perspectives on the press coverage, the negative stories, and the impact of these narratives on their mental health and well-being. This is probably one of the most controversial aspects of the series, as it tackles head-on the often-strained relationship between the Royal Family and the media. Finally, the series features their new life in the United States. Viewers get a glimpse of their new home, their charitable work, and their efforts to build a life on their own terms. This segment emphasizes their journey toward independence and their efforts to establish themselves in a new environment, far removed from the constraints of royal life. One of the series' most powerful moments is the couple’s open discussion about their mental health struggles. Both Harry and Meghan share their personal experiences, highlighting the emotional toll of public life and the importance of seeking help. These moments of vulnerability offer an important message to viewers, emphasizing the value of emotional well-being and the courage required to address mental health challenges. They reveal the deep emotional scars left by the relentless media scrutiny and the pressure to maintain a public image. This offers viewers a chance to understand the human cost of these public roles. The series also takes a look at race and diversity, especially concerning Meghan's experiences as a biracial woman within the Royal Family. It delves into the microaggressions, the unspoken rules, and the challenges of being an outsider within a traditional institution. They share specific incidents, discussing the implicit biases and the cultural adjustments necessary to navigate a role within the monarchy. The Impact: Reactions and Controversy
Alright, let’s talk about the buzz! The Harry & Meghan docuseries has undeniably had a significant impact. From the moment it was announced, it became a global talking point. The reactions have been mixed, to say the least. On the one hand, many viewers have expressed deep empathy for Harry and Meghan, praising their courage to speak out and share their story. These viewers were touched by the personal narrative of the docuseries. They see it as a candid portrayal of the couple’s experiences and challenges. Support for the couple has been strong from those who empathize with their experiences. There is a lot of criticism of the media and Royal Family. On the other hand, there has been some serious backlash, especially from critics who accuse the couple of airing grievances publicly and potentially damaging the reputation of the Royal Family. The criticism often questions the accuracy of some claims made in the docuseries, with some commentators calling for more objective documentation. Some critics have suggested the series is a calculated move to monetize their personal experiences. The controversy surrounding the docuseries raises questions about media ethics and the right to privacy, especially for public figures. Many question the balance between the couple's right to tell their story and the potential impact on the institution of the monarchy. It's a complex issue with no easy answers. The reaction from the Royal Family has been notably measured. There have been no direct responses to the claims made in the series. Some royal commentators have suggested this silence is part of a deliberate strategy to avoid escalating tensions. Whatever their perspective on the events depicted in the series, the Royal Family’s response reflects the sensitivity of the situation. Some royal watchers claim that the Royal Family's silence is an attempt to avoid a media storm, while others see it as a sign of respect for the couple’s privacy. The debate is ongoing.
